AU-Supported Software Applications


The Office of Information Technology supports a wide variety of software applications. Many of the applications listed below have been licensed for use by all AU Faculty, Staff, and Students, or else they are freely available. Please click on any of the links below to learn more about our supported software applications.

 

General Applications (Available to All AU Faculty, Staff, and Students)

  • AU Campus Connect - AU's emergency alert system 
  • Blackboard - AU's Web-based e-learning application used to supplement most classes 
  • Cisco Clean Access - AU's network authentication system, which performs a "health check" on all computers prior to accessing the network.
  • CommonSpot - AU's content management system for posting university Web content.
  • EndNote X2 - AU's site-licensed citation and bibliographic software 
  • Listserv E-mail Lists - E-mail lists facilitate communication with others sharing similar interests 
  • Mozilla Firefox - AU's recommended Web browser 
  • my.american.edu - AU's Web portal, your secure, personal gateway to information and services 
  • MyIDProtector - a site-licensed self-audit tool to check to see if you have confidential data stored on your computer 
  • OpenOffice.org Office Suite - a free open-source alternative to the Microsoft Office Suite for Windows, Macintosh, and Linux. 
  • Prosoft - a site-licensed application enabling Macintosh users to access personal or departmental network drives at AU
  • Symantec Antivirus - AU's site-licensed virus scanning software 
  • VPN - a tool for securely connecting to AU network resources from anywhere in the world

 

Student Applications

  • AU-Sponsored Gmail - connect to your AU-sponsored Gmail account either through the Web or through a configured IMAP mail client 
  • EagleBuck$ Printing - AU's campus-wide pay-for-printing system, used in computer labs, libraries, and residence halls 
  • eSUDS - AU's fully-computerized laundry service, used in the residence halls 
  • Microsoft Office (Academic Discount) - AU's recommended Office suite for Windows and Macintosh computers, including Word, Excel, and PowerPoint. This software can be purchased at an academic discount from the Campus Bookstore or other computer vendors.

 

Faculty and Staff Applications

  • Datatel Colleague and Colleague Advancement - AU's administrative computing systems with modules to manage student academic records, financial information, human resources records, and support the development initiatives at the university. 
  • Datatel UI - the user interface for accessing the Datatel system 
  • EagleData - a Web-accessible source for university statistics and reports 
  • Faculty and Staff E-mail Options - access your AU e-mail via the Lotus Notes client, through the Web, or through a configured IMAP mail client 
  • Microsoft Office - AU's recommended Office suite for Windows and Macintosh computers, including Word, Excel, and PowerPoint. This software is licensed for home and office use by AU faculty and staff.
